To determine whether an object moves easier over a smooth or rough surface, you need to understand the concept of friction.

Friction is the force that resists the relative motion between two objects in contact. When an object moves across a surface, friction acts in the opposite direction of the motion, making it harder for the object to move. The roughness or smoothness of a surface affects the magnitude of friction.

Generally, an object moves easier over a smooth surface compared to a rough surface. This is because a smooth surface has less irregularities and fewer obstacles for the object to overcome. Smooth surfaces allow for less friction to develop, resulting in easier movement of objects.

To experience this firsthand, you can conduct a simple experiment. Take an object such as a book and try pushing it across a smooth table or a rough carpeted floor. You will notice that it requires less force to move the book on the smooth table as compared to the rough carpeted floor.

It's worth noting that the type of object and the nature of the surface also play a role. For example, some objects, such as wheels on a car or ball bearings, are designed to minimize friction and roll more easily on any surface.

In summary, objects tend to move easier over a smooth surface compared to a rough surface due to the lower amount of friction encountered.
